C9H20ClNO2 — CID 11701275
(3S,5R)-3-amino-5-methyloctanoic acid;hydrochloride (PubChem CID 11701275) has the molecular formula C9H20ClNO2 and a molecular weight of 209.72 g/mol. Its IUPAC name is (3S,5R)-3-amino-5-methyloctanoic acid;hydrochloride.
| Compound Name | (3S,5R)-3-amino-5-methyloctanoic acid;hydrochloride |
|---|---|
| PubChem CID | 11701275 |
| Molecular Formula | C9H20ClNO2 |
| Molecular Weight | 209.72 g/mol |
| Exact Mass | 209.12 |
| IUPAC Name | (3S,5R)-3-amino-5-methyloctanoic acid;hydrochloride |
| SMILES | CCC[C@@H](C)C[C@H](N)CC(=O)O.Cl |
| InChI | InChI=1S/C9H19NO2.ClH/c1-3-4-7(2)5-8(10)6-9(11)12;/h7-8H,3-6,10H2,1-2H3,(H,11,12);1H/t7-,8+;/m1./s1 |
| InChIKey | CFMZXQJDAJXNHS-WLYNEOFISA-N |
| XLogP | 2.04 |
| TPSA | 63.32 Ų |
| H-Bond Donors | 2 |
| H-Bond Acceptors | 2 |
| Rotatable Bonds | 6 |
| Heavy Atoms | 13 |
